A&E to Premiere New Original Series EPIC INK, 8/20
By: Caryn Robbins Jul. 02, 2014
A&E Network presents the new original series "Epic Ink," following the artwork and exploits of the staff at a tattoo shop unlike any other, Area 51 Tattoo, located in Springfield, Oregon. Area 51 sits at the intersection of pop culture and cutting-edge tattoo art. The artists at Area 51 specialize in hyper-realistic tattoos featuring beloved characters and scenes from favorite sci-fi films and pop culture. "Epic Ink" premieres Wednesday, August 20 at 10:30PM ET/PT.
In each episode of "Epic Ink," the talented staff brings comics, cartoons and fantasy to life with unique ink ranging from portraiture to hyperrealism, to geek-culture mash-ups. From closet nerds to creative cosplayers, sci-fi fans travel to Springfield from across the country to get tattoos from the artists at the shop. The Area 51 clientele even includes a few celebrities, such as Butch Patrick (Eddie Munster) and the Mistress of the Dark herself, Elvira, who appears in an upcoming episode to get her very first tattoo. In between clients, the staff is likely to be found debating over who would win a fight - Spock or Chewbacca - or which '80s Saturday morning cartoon was best.
